Pdoggg Posted August 20, 2022 Share Posted August 20, 2022 Pattaya —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ation chose to host its International Conference on Family Planning or ICEP 2022 in Pattaya from November 14th to 17th, 2022. Pattaya mayor Poramese Ngampiches on Friday, August 19th, revealed that he planned to welcome the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ation, which will fly to Pattaya to host its International Conference on Family Planning (ICEP 2022) from November 14th to 17th at Pattaya Exhibition and Convention Hall. Poramese said that the purpose of this conference is to exchange knowledge, research findings, and innovations on establishing a family and supporting a healthy lifestyle in rural households. About 15,000 leading figures in relevant fields from 150 countries will attend this meeting, the mayor said. The reason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ation chose to host this conference in Pattaya, according to Poramese, was that Pattaya was ready in several aspects such as location and culture. He believed that this conference will make Pattaya even more reputable and bring lots of tourists to the city.
